Magento SQLSTATE [HY000]:常规错误:单击“管理产品”选项时出现内存不足(需要268435428字节)错误

时间:2014-07-07 11:55:48

标签: magento

点击Magento 1.7中的manage product选项时出现SQLSTATE[HY000]: General error: 5 Out of memory (Needed 268435428 bytes)错误。任何人都可以指导可能的解决方案。提前谢谢。

2 个答案:

答案 0 :(得分:2)

看起来你的服务器没有足够的内存来同时运行php和MySQL。

虽然其他人已经提到增加php.ini中的php memory_limit,但是由于MySQL内存耗尽而不是php,你会遇到更深层次的问题:

注意错误源是MySQL - > SQLSTATE[HY000]: General error: 5 Out of memory (Needed 268435428 bytes)

获得标准的php堆栈溢出 - > Fatal error: Out of memory (allocated 247463936) (tried to allocate 261900 bytes) in somepath/to/some/file.php

服务器不足以满足需求,或者在此服务器上严重错误配置。您需要更多内存来运行整个电子商务网站。当MySQL没有提供足够的资源时,预计会丢失数据。

答案 1 :(得分:0)

我在my.ini文件上进行了以下配置。

  

key_buffer = 1600M

     

max_allowed_pa​​cket = 64M

     

sort_buffer_size = 512M

     

net_buffer_length = 80K

     

read_buffer_size = 256M